  • I spent a night at The Meridien thanks to a free gift certificate I won from the amazing Yelp team almost a year ago! I booked it for the night of Friday October 10- we were granted a spacious deluxe room with king bed. The exterior and lobby of the hotel are by no means impressive but the newly renovated rooms are well decorated, modern and bright. We stayed in room 655 which had huge windows overlooking St Mathieu street and corner of Sherbooke. PROS: centrally located, lots of space, free functional wifi, clean room, great toiletries (shampoo/conditionner/lotion/showergel/soap bar). I was particularly impressed with the conditionner, having very long hair, I was able to comb through and detangle in a breeze. Plus their products have a light citrusy, exotic smell. My bf said it reminded him of pina colada, so even though we were just on a staycation, I could picture myself somewhere tropical. LOVE the cotton bathrobe, super comfy and made me feel like a VIP. Bedsheets and towels were soft and smelled like crisp clean detergent. CONS: AC automatically turns itself on and off after reaching a certain temperature- we couldn't keep the room as cool as we would have liked. Bathroom is tiny, there's space for just one person to stand at the sink. Flat screen tv is not HD, most channels appear blurry. Despite the renovated room, there were cracks in the ceiling and wall (see my attached photos) And this is the worse - If you're a fan of firm mattresses, this bed will be a real nightmare. Much too soft, you sink in, almost impossible to sit upright and watch tv or read a book. Pillows were also mush. Best description would be like sleeping on a huge marshmallow- sounds like fun at first, but it was a restless night as we were constantly tossing and turning. I sleep flat on my back and I kid you not, morning come, my body was bent into a V shape from sinking so deep. In all, my personal preference for firm mattresses affected the quality of my stay but I would still recommend it for the location - steps from Guy Concordia metro, but not in the busy arteries, away from bars and clubs so it's a quiet area if you're looking for something relaxing.
